I am a current owner of a 1988 Pontiac Lemans Areocoupe. I have racked up well over 160,000 miles on the ODO, and I STILL love it. My specs are as follows...
1.6 Litre engine (Around 98 cubic inches...) Think about the same size as a classic Subaru or VW Bug! ;)
TBI fuel injected
5 speed stick
hatchback rear seats can fold down for cargo space.
AT the presant time I get...
45 MPG in town
58 MPG on the highway
(The above are both calculated via a computer attached to the car.)
uses about half a quart of oil between changes (5000 miles).
Built like a tank! I live in montana, and take her up into the hills all the time.
